From 2907e45ad103761c64792393b03e0dcba09cc54a Mon Sep 17 00:00:00 2001 From: Robert Mosolgo Date: Mon, 28 Apr 2025 13:03:31 -0400 Subject: [PATCH 1/5] Add a ruby head build --- .github/workflows/ci.yaml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/ci.yaml b/.github/workflows/ci.yaml index 9153791a038..c9c9e312414 100644 --- a/.github/workflows/ci.yaml +++ b/.github/workflows/ci.yaml @@ -46,7 +46,7 @@ jobs: matrix: include: - gemfile: Gemfile - ruby: 3.4 + ruby: head - gemfile: Gemfile ruby: 2.7 # lowest supported version - gemfile: gemfiles/rails_7.0.gemfile From ae22de2332c332e6d84f45d2f4efb6914a156ea9 Mon Sep 17 00:00:00 2001 From: Robert Mosolgo Date: Mon, 28 Apr 2025 13:09:32 -0400 Subject: [PATCH 2/5] Remove pry-byebug --- Gemfile | 1 - 1 file changed, 1 deletion(-) diff --git a/Gemfile b/Gemfile index 69aca9d35af..5d534650141 100644 --- a/Gemfile +++ b/Gemfile @@ -7,7 +7,6 @@ gem 'bootsnap' # required by the Rails apps generated in tests gem 'stackprof', platform: :ruby gem 'pry' gem 'pry-stack_explorer', platform: :ruby -gem 'pry-byebug' if RUBY_VERSION >= "3.0" gem "libev_scheduler" From 8955e17d8bae0502b10d1cf9954cf4d04f95252d Mon Sep 17 00:00:00 2001 From: Robert Mosolgo Date: Mon, 28 Apr 2025 13:19:16 -0400 Subject: [PATCH 3/5] Remove benchmark require --- spec/spec_helper.rb | 1 - 1 file changed, 1 deletion(-) diff --git a/spec/spec_helper.rb b/spec/spec_helper.rb index f454eb341d6..c6b55790a5b 100644 --- a/spec/spec_helper.rb +++ b/spec/spec_helper.rb @@ -44,7 +44,6 @@ require "rake" require "graphql/rake_task" -require "benchmark" require "pry" require "minitest/autorun" require "minitest/focus" From b5ab58fba14fa0477e659596fe10063f23ed301f Mon Sep 17 00:00:00 2001 From: Robert Mosolgo Date: Mon, 28 Apr 2025 13:20:32 -0400 Subject: [PATCH 4/5] Add dev dependency on ostruct --- graphql.gemspec | 1 + 1 file changed, 1 insertion(+) diff --git a/graphql.gemspec b/graphql.gemspec index 8d6abf35e5a..abb03cd8497 100644 --- a/graphql.gemspec +++ b/graphql.gemspec @@ -38,6 +38,7 @@ Gem::Specification.new do |s| s.add_development_dependency "minitest" s.add_development_dependency "minitest-focus" s.add_development_dependency "minitest-reporters" + s.add_development_dependency "ostruct" s.add_development_dependency "rake" s.add_development_dependency 'rake-compiler' s.add_development_dependency "rubocop" From 612b4c60e900a6405719bc040ca3520183ddcd1a Mon Sep 17 00:00:00 2001 From: Robert Mosolgo Date: Mon, 28 Apr 2025 13:24:26 -0400 Subject: [PATCH 5/5] require yaml --- spec/support/rubocop_test_helpers.rb | 1 + 1 file changed, 1 insertion(+) diff --git a/spec/support/rubocop_test_helpers.rb b/spec/support/rubocop_test_helpers.rb index 001e402890e..09086809958 100644 --- a/spec/support/rubocop_test_helpers.rb +++ b/spec/support/rubocop_test_helpers.rb @@ -1,4 +1,5 @@ # frozen_string_literal: true +require "yaml" module RubocopTestHelpers def run_rubocop_on(fixture_path, autocorrect: false)